Hello all. My wife and I own a 3/2 single story home, 1100 square
feet.
We are thinking of adding a second story to increase the living space.
There's not too much room to add outward, hence we thought a second
story would make the most sense.
The home was built in 1948 and is a post and beam construction with a
crawl space. The current roof is a rafter style construction and
there is one large load bearing wall running through the middle of the
house.
Is it a major deal adding a second story to a post and beam home, i.e.
jacking up the house to reinforce the beams, etc.. etc..
Any other thoughts from those who have attempted this?
